Output efe052d20dc1f6252be8551c8ac9268dde1551d99fa56ccf0853fc63deafea2a:1

value
1650443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0d2728e98ec98198de0ede34ea560a3ec15c5ab OP_EQUAL
address
3PeNCjLxxiCHLeVit3fK2LG6JNvGFksgqe
transaction
efe052d20dc1f6252be8551c8ac9268dde1551d99fa56ccf0853fc63deafea2a
confirmations
287517
spent
true